City Sports Bar TRYSON Chimbetu looks like he is in a bid to revive his waning fortunes. Poor management and bad behaviour have left the young musician down as he has been relegated to the doldrums in terms of the inevitable fierce competition in the Chimbetu family. Yet it is the stage that normally redeems one and on Sunday he is granted a chance to do just that.

Long Cheng Plaza

It’s the Look East Policy affair for the University of Zimbabwe SRC that hosts a cocktail of dancehall musicians at Long Cheng Plaza tonight. The event will also be a welcome bash for first-year students that have enrolled at the institution of higher learning.

Artistes expected to perform at the event include Ricky Fire, Shinsoman, Trevor D, Junior Brown, Skatta Watta, Icey, J Boss, Mafia 19, and Mighty Ducks.

Super Label

Long-forgotten dancehall musician Badman returns from South Africa where he has been holed up for several years. The artiste, who used to be the only credible competition for Ninja President Winky D, is launching his comeback album Champion Talk at an event that will also be graced by the explosive Lady Squanda among others. For dancehall, the venue is tried and tested while the artiste should be on top of the game to cause an upset on the cut-throat Zimbabwean scene.

Gijima Sports Bar

Gijima Sports Bar tomorrow makes a change after a series of consecutive Mbira Fridays and hosts veteran jazz outfit Pied Pipers. The predominantly Mbare group has an interesting approach to the genre that should leave many sweating on the dance floor.

New Life

Sungura ace Alick Macheso returns to Budiriro for a show at New Life Nite Club tonight. The venue is regarded one of the best hunting grounds by musicians and the show should sure warm up the unusual September nights currently characterising the imminent summer.

Pamuzinda Highway Escape

It will mainly be a DJ affair at Pamuzinda this weekend starting with DJs Bash and Glory tonight. Tomorrow former Globetrotter entertainer Jazzy F plays alongside guest DJ Cables. On Sunday it will be a Mangerengere affair with Progress Chipfumo playing at a free show alongside a variety of DJs.

Dulibadzimu Stadium Beitbridge

Alick Macheso performs in the southern border town tomorrow evening. The shows at the stadium never disappoint with multitudes of travellers making time to watch live performances. On Sunday the musician crosses into Midlands for a family show at Caravan Park in Zvishavane to entertain platinum miners and gold panners.

Rits Nite Club Masvingo

The Young Igwe performs at Ritz Nite Club in Masvingo tonight. He will be accompanied by Beverly Sibanda and the Sexy Angels. The duo take their romance to Chiredzi for a show at Chikangwe Hall before Peter goes solo on Sunday for a show in Chivi.
